7th February 2013 - During a routine inspection pdf icon

We spoke with eight people who attended the practice on the day of our inspection. They told us that they were very happy with the service they received.

People told us that they had been satisfied with the outcomes of their treatment. They said that the quality of their dental work was “Excellent”.

We saw that staff greeted people in a warm and friendly manner. Everyone told us that their privacy and dignity was maintained at all times.

People who received a service said that they had been involved in making decisions about their dental care and treatment options. They said they were given clear information that enabled them to make informed choices.

Staff told us they were well supported in their work. They said they received regular training opportunities and ongoing support in order to carry out their jobs effectively.

We saw that the practice had procedures in place for the management of infection control. Staff had received training to reduce the risk of cross infection. People told us that they thought standards of cleanliness were, “Very good”.

People we spoke with were not aware of the formal complaints process but said that they would be confident to speak with staff if they had a worry or concern. Information was available should people want to make a complaint in an information leaflet on reception. A policy and procedure was in place although it needed minor changes to ensure information was consistent in all documents.
